Overview

«Hay algo que los hombres ansían más que el dinero: el poder. Algunos lo tienen, otros sueñan con él
antes de dormir, y otros lo combaten. Tú eres una amenaza para el poder, Gloria, porque desobedeces y además eres mujer. El poder siempre buscará aplastarte, nunca bajes la guardia.»
 
UNA TIERRA MALDITA
 
Año 1889, La Rioja. Hay quien dice que una maldición se ciñe sobre los viñedos, secos desde hace años, de la finca Las Urracas. Mientras las grandes bodegas de la región comienzan su edad dorada, Gloria -la joven hija del propietario- languidece en la vieja mansión familiar, viendo aproximarse otro otoño sin cosecha.

UNA MUJER DISPUESTA A LUCHAR POR EL PODER
 
Sometida a la autoridad de una tía cruel y un padre ausente, Gloria verá cambiar su vida de un día para otro cuando tenga que ponerse al frente del negocio familiar. Será entonces cuando comience una larga batalla que la enfrentará a los bodegueros y caciques locales, que no conciben tener como rival a una mujer. Y menos a una que pone en duda sus viejos privilegios#
 
UN GRAN MISTERIO QUE DEBE SALIR A LA LUZ
 
Con la ayuda de sus hermanas, Gloria luchará por recuperar el esplendor de sus viñedos, al tiempo que se adentra en los secretos que esconden las habitaciones cerradas y los campos muertos de Las Urracas.

Bajo la sombra de una maldición que solo al final sabremos si es cierta, las mujeres de esta novela lucharán, sin miedo a nada ni a nadie, por el poder que les pertenece.
 
ENGLISH DESCRIPTION

There is something that men want more than money: power. Some have it, others dream of it before sleeping, and others fight it. You are a threat to power, Gloria, because you disobey, and on top of that, you’re a woman. Power will always seek to crush you; never let your guard down.
 
A CURSED LAND

La Rioja, 1889. Some say that a curse lies over the vineyards of Las Urracas, which have been dry for years. While the big wineries in the region begin their golden age, Gloria—the owner’s young daughter—languishes in the old family mansion, watching another autumn come and go without a crop.
 
A WOMAN WILLING TO FIGHT FOR POWER

Under the authority of a cruel aunt and an absent father, Gloria sees her life change from one day to the next when she has to take charge of the family business. This is the beginning of a long battle that pits her against the winery owners and local bigwigs, who can’t imagine having a woman as a rival, much less one who casts doubts on their old privileges.
 
A MYSTERY THAT MUST COME TO LIGHT

With the help of her sisters, Gloria fights to recover the splendor of her vineyards while delving into the secrets hidden in the closed bedrooms and dead fields of Las Urracas. Under the shadow of a curse that may or may not be true, the women in this novel fight, fearless of anything and anyone, for the power that is rightfully theirs.
